    Google's AI Breakthrough Brings Quantum Computing Nearer to Actual-World Functions – Decrypt

    Google researchers have found a brand new method that would lastly make quantum computing sensible in actual life, utilizing synthetic intelligence to resolve one in all science’s most persistent challenges: extra steady states.

    In a analysis paper revealed in Nature, Google Deepmind scientists clarify that their new AI system, AlphaQubit, has confirmed remarkably profitable at correcting the persistent errors which have lengthy plagued quantum computer systems.

    “Quantum computer systems have the potential to revolutionize drug discovery, materials design, and elementary physics—that’s, if we are able to get them to work reliably,” Google’s announcement reads. However nothing is ideal: quantum programs are terribly fragile. Even the slightest environmental interference—from warmth, vibration, electromagnetic fields, and even cosmic rays—can disrupt their delicate quantum states, resulting in errors that make computations unreliable.

    A March analysis paper highlights the problem: quantum computer systems want an error price of only one in a trillion operations (10^-12) for sensible use. Nonetheless, present {hardware} has error charges between 10^-3 and 10^-2 per operation, making error correction essential.

    “Sure issues, which might take a standard laptop billions of years to resolve, would take a quantum laptop simply hours,” Google states. “Nonetheless, these new processors are extra liable to noise than standard ones.”

    “If we need to make quantum computer systems extra dependable, particularly at scale, we have to precisely establish and proper these errors.”

    Google’s new AI system, AlphaQubit, desires to sort out this difficulty. The AI system employs a complicated neural community structure that has demonstrated unprecedented accuracy in figuring out and correcting quantum errors, displaying 6% fewer errors than earlier greatest strategies in large-scale experiments and 30% fewer errors than conventional strategies.

    It additionally maintained excessive accuracy throughout quantum programs starting from 17 qubits to 241 qubits—which means that the strategy may scale to the bigger programs wanted for sensible quantum computing.

    Beneath the Hood

    AlphaQubit employs a two-stage strategy to realize its excessive accuracy.

    The system first trains on simulated quantum noise knowledge, studying normal patterns of quantum errors, then adapts to actual quantum {hardware} utilizing a restricted quantity of experimental knowledge.

    This strategy permits AlphaQubit to deal with complicated real-world quantum noise results, together with cross-talk between qubits, leakage (when qubits exit their computational states), and delicate correlations between various kinds of errors.

    However don’t get too excited; you received’t have a quantum laptop in your storage quickly.

    Regardless of its accuracy, AlphaQubit nonetheless faces vital hurdles earlier than sensible implementation. “Every consistency verify in a quick superconducting quantum processor is measured one million instances each second,” the researchers be aware. “Whereas AlphaQubit is nice at precisely figuring out errors, it is nonetheless too sluggish to appropriate errors in a superconducting processor in real-time.”

    “Coaching at bigger code distances is tougher as a result of the examples are extra complicated, and pattern effectivity seems decrease at bigger distances,” a Deepmind spokesperson advised Decrypt, ” It’s essential as a result of error price scales exponentially with code distance, so we anticipate to want to resolve bigger distances to get the ultra-low error charges wanted for fault-tolerant computation on giant, deep quantum circuits.

    The researchers are specializing in pace optimization, scalability, and integration as crucial areas for future improvement.

    AI and quantum computing type a synergistic relationship, enhancing the opposite’s potential. “We anticipate AI/ML and quantum computing to stay complementary approaches to computation. AI may be utilized in different areas to assist the event of fault-tolerant quantum computer systems, corresponding to calibration and compilation or algorithm design,” the spokesperson advised Decrypt, “on the similar time, individuals are wanting into quantum ML functions for quantum knowledge, and extra speculatively, for quantum ML algorithms on classical knowledge.

    This convergence would possibly symbolize an important turning level in computational science. As quantum computer systems turn out to be extra dependable by AI-assisted error correction, they may, in flip, assist develop extra refined AI programs, creating a strong suggestions loop of technological development.

    The age of sensible quantum computing, lengthy promised however by no means delivered, would possibly lastly be nearer—although not fairly shut sufficient to begin worrying a few cyborg apocalypse.
